Pelican expands into travel luggage, bags & gear

pelican trvl travel roller suitcases duffel bags backpacks and slings.

Already got the hard cases but need travel bags, suitcases, and better organization inside them? The new Pelican TRVL series offers just that, with three new segments to accompany their hard-shelled boxes. The TRVL goods come in three collections:

  • ATX Series – Tough hardshell luggage
  • Aegis Series – Softshell luggage & packs
  • ModPak – Packing cubes & organization

Pelican ATX

The ATX series is the most similar to the Pelican Air cases we all know, with a hard, waterproof, crushproof, and rustproof “Pelican Armor” outer shell with air pressure equalization valve. The travel friendliness comes via retractable handle, Hinomoto 360º Mobility Spinner Wheels, TSA-approved locking latches, and internal organization.

Inside is a ripstop liner, compression straps, and zippered compartments. Hardware is repairable or replaceable, and it’s made in the USA. Three sizes:

  • Carry-on: 22.00” X 14.00” X 9.10” (11.6lbs / $574.95)
  • Medium Check-in: 26.00” x 18.00” x 10.60” (18.5lbs / $689.95)
  • Large Check-in: 30.00” x 20.00” x 12.10” (21.9lbs / $799.95)

Most Pelican TRVL products are available one or more of these four colors – Black, Indigo, Sand, and Charcoal.

Pelican Aegis

Aegis series is the soft-sided collection, with a rolling duffel, sling bags, and travel pack. The Rolling Duffel has a hard EVA-molded front shell and weather-resistant 500D Cordura fabric.

Heavy-duty, oversized wheels keep it rolling over rough terrain, and the extending handle, multiple grab handles, and compression straps make it easy to manage. Zippered pockets inside and out ease organization. Available in three sizes: 22″ (7.3lbs / $379.95), 28″ (9.35lbs / $439.95), and 32″ (10.49lbs / $499.95).

The Travel Pack backpack also has an EVA-molded front shell to give it shape, with padded & shaped shoulder straps, breathable back padding with channels for air flow & luggage pass-thru sleeve, compression straps, laptop sleeve, zippered pockets throughout, and various attachment points.

Available in two sizes: 18L (2.69lbs / $229.95) and 25L (2.87lbs / $269.95). Perfect for warm weekend getaways and overnight work trips.

The boxy Aegis slings are the thing for daily outings, with three options depending on size and how much protection you need for their contents.

The Access Sling (0.6lbs / $69.95) is minimal, the Padded Sling (1.18lbs / $89.95) adds a bit of cushion, and the Protective Sling (shown, 1.21lbs / $99.95) adds an EVA-molded front shell for structure. They’re made with Cordura fabric & YKK zippers and include waist and shoulder straps so you can wear ’em however you like.

Pelican ModPak

Designed to live inside the others, the ModPak series offers small/medium/large packing cubes, storage pouches, AV pouches, and a toiletry bag.

They’re made with Cordura or a breathable Mono-Mesh, use YKK zips, and have grab handles, a nice touch not found on every packing cube. Prices range from $19.95 to $89.95.
